Pengying Jia is a scholar working on Radiology, Nuclear Medicine and Imaging, Electrical and Electronic Engineering and Surfaces, Coatings and Films. According to data from OpenAlex, Pengying Jia has authored 90 papers receiving a total of 770 indexed citations (citations by other indexed papers that have themselves been cited), including 83 papers in Radiology, Nuclear Medicine and Imaging, 80 papers in Electrical and Electronic Engineering and 6 papers in Surfaces, Coatings and Films. Recurrent topics in Pengying Jia’s work include Plasma Applications and Diagnostics (83 papers), Plasma Diagnostics and Applications (63 papers) and Electrohydrodynamics and Fluid Dynamics (50 papers). Pengying Jia is often cited by papers focused on Plasma Applications and Diagnostics (83 papers), Plasma Diagnostics and Applications (63 papers) and Electrohydrodynamics and Fluid Dynamics (50 papers). Pengying Jia collaborates with scholars based in China. Pengying Jia's co-authors include Xuechen Li, Kaiyue Wu, Panpan Zhang, Kun Gao, Lifang Dong, Junxia Ran, Junyu Chen, Qi Zhang, Ning Yuan and Shuai Zhou and has published in prestigious journals such as The Astrophysical Journal, Applied Physics Letters and Journal of Applied Physics.
